John Hagee (September-12-2025) Daily Devotion: Acts 3:19 - Repent therefore and be converted, that your sins may be blotted out, so that times of refreshing may come from the presence of the Lord

The message of Jesus is not one of tolerance for sin, but the confession and forsaking of sin to pursue Him and His path. His message is repentance and restoration.

Repentance involves not only a deep sorrow for the sin that we have committed, but a changing of our hearts and minds and actions. It requires a turning back to God, a realigning to His purposes.

We choose right over wrong, ethics over convenience, truth over popularity, and Christ over all. He is Lord of all or He is not Lord at all.

And, oh the joy that we experience when He completely erases and blots out our sins! They are washed away in the blood of Jesus, and we savor the peace of being in right relationship with the Father. We are clean and renewed!

After knowing the fierce heat of conviction and the barrenness of our souls outside of the Father’s will, we now can experience His presence like a cool breeze and a refreshing drink of water.

Submit every piece of your life to Him. When we repent and choose to conform to God’s Word and His pattern of thinking, He transforms our minds and keeps us in perfect peace as we stay focused on Him. Make Him Lord of all your life.

What You Should Know about Pastor John Hagee Introduction Pastor John Charles Hagee is a notable figure in the Christian evangelical world, renowned for his role as the founder and Senior Pastor of Cornerstone Church in San Antonio, Texas. Born on April 12, 1940, in Goose Creek, Texas, Hagee has established a significant presence both in religious circles and in the broader socio-political arena. His education includes a Bachelor of Science degree from Southwestern Assemblies of God University in Waxahachie, Texas, another Bachelor of Science degree from Trinity University in San Antonio, Texas, and a Master’s Degree in Educational Administration from the University of North Texas in Denton, Texas. He has also received Honorary Doctorates from several institutions, including Oral Roberts University and Netanya Academic College of Israel.
